    The government’s effort in allocating RM36.1 billion for the healthcare sector—the second highest allocation after the education sector—indicates a focus on the Government’s agenda to nurture the well-being of the rakyat and strengthen the resilience of our healthcare industry.

    In conjunction with Breast Cancer Awareness this October, we applaud the Government’s timely allocation of RM11 million to subsidise mammograms and cervical cancer tests for women.     The Malaysian Healthcare Travel Council’s allocation of RM20 million will strengthen our nation’s position as a destination for medical tourists who are seeking to undergo treatment in Malaysia—another welcome initiative.     The mental health of our fellow Malaysians is something that needs to be taken seriously and it is important that we have the essential support needed to facilitate this. Hence, we hope that the Government’s allocation of RM20 million to provide additional mental health resources will serve to increase awareness and reduce the stigma surrounding mental health issues.
